Being a landlord comes with many responsibilities, from managing properties to dealing with tenant issues. One important aspect of being a landlord is understanding the legalities involved in renting out properties. This is where a landlord solicitor comes in handy. A landlord solicitor is a legal professional who specializes in dealing with issues related to landlord-tenant relationships. In this article, we will discuss the importance of hiring a landlord solicitor and how they can help landlords navigate the complex world of rental properties.
First and foremost, a landlord solicitor can provide invaluable advice and guidance on landlord-tenant law. Rental laws can vary significantly from one jurisdiction to another, and it is crucial for landlords to be aware of their rights and responsibilities under the law. A landlord solicitor will have a thorough understanding of the relevant laws and regulations and can advise landlords on how to comply with them. This can help landlords avoid legal issues and disputes with tenants down the line.
One of the most common reasons landlords end up in legal trouble is due to issues related to tenancy agreements. A landlord solicitor can help landlords draft legally binding and comprehensive tenancy agreements that protect their interests. This includes outlining the rights and responsibilities of both parties, setting out the terms of the tenancy, and including clauses that protect the landlord in case of a breach of agreement by the tenant. Having a well-drafted tenancy agreement can help landlords prevent disputes and uphold their legal rights in case of a disagreement with a tenant.
In addition to drafting tenancy agreements, a landlord solicitor can also assist landlords with other legal documents related to renting out properties. This includes dealing with issues such as rent arrears, evictions, property damage, and disputes over deposits. A landlord solicitor can help landlords navigate these issues effectively and ensure that they are in compliance with the law when resolving disputes with tenants. This can save landlords time, money, and stress in the long run.
Moreover, a landlord solicitor can represent landlords in court proceedings if a dispute with a tenant escalates to the point where legal action is necessary. Whether it is seeking possession of a property, recovering unpaid rent, or defending against a tenant’s claim, a landlord solicitor can provide expert legal representation in court. This can be particularly beneficial for landlords who are unfamiliar with the legal process and want to ensure their interests are protected in court.
Another important role of a landlord solicitor is to provide advice on landlord responsibilities under health and safety regulations. Landlords have a legal obligation to ensure that their properties are safe and habitable for tenants. This includes complying with building codes, maintaining essential services such as heating and plumbing, and conducting regular inspections to identify and address potential hazards. A landlord solicitor can advise landlords on their responsibilities under health and safety regulations and help them take proactive steps to ensure their properties are compliant with the law.
